Output 68666e8791a120c88506916ddd5186f3800975fad1f5b149e9b73039745b386f:0

value
139979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b1ef249d79020552a83a4b795dfdb03a5cd95d OP_EQUAL
address
33DHthFCTn9SyVtjQdbv5bux4bJYqrmxfL
transaction
68666e8791a120c88506916ddd5186f3800975fad1f5b149e9b73039745b386f
spent
true